The Levels of Functional-Vegetative Homeostasis as Criteria for Magnetotherapy Efficacy

Abstract: Background. Disorders of autonomic nervous system caused up to 80% of functional disorders. There is no information about the influence of magnetotherapy (MT) on the indicators of vegetative homeostasis, which disturbance is a cause of functional pathology.Objectives. The aim of the study is to investigate vegetative rehabilitation trend of MT in various initial conditions of functional-vegetative disorders.Methods. Functional-vegetative diagnostics method by V.G. Makats was chosen as a method of control of MT… Show more

“…Animal studies support the hypothesis that PEMF can be useful in therapy ( 27 30 ), e.g., in cardiac diseases ( 27 , 30 , 31 ). In humans, PEMF could normalize dysautonomia in children ( 32 , 33 ) and was found to be effective to treat neuropathic/postsurgical pain and edema as well as several other indications ( 34 – 37 ). PEMF acupuncture of BL15 (bladder meridian and paravertebral T5) was found to activate the parasympathetic nervous system ( 38 ).…”
